What We Do
ANSER is a public service research institute organized as a not-for-profit corporation and dedicated to informing decisions that shape the Nation’s future. We provide objective studies and analyses to the national security, homeland security, and public policy communities using a diverse set of capabilities that include analysis of alternatives, acquisition analysis, workforce analysis, performance measurement, policy formulation, countering weapons of mass destruction, and risk assessment. ANSER also builds and leads technology development collaborations through its subsidiary, Advanced Technology International (ATI), which specializes in organizing and managing research and development consortia on behalf of the federal government.
